KiwiHarvest tackles two big problems with one clever solution: rescuing food before it goes to waste and redistributing it to those who need it most. The work of the KiwiHarvest team and its fantastic volunteers reduces the environmental impact of food waste and also drives positive social change across the Southern Lakes region.
For Queenstown Airport, this partnership is a perfect fit. KiwiHarvest’s reach spans our entire catchment, supporting charities in Queenstown, Wānaka and Cromwell, while also addressing our region’s collective goal to divert waste from landfill.
Queenstown Airport has committed to providing $25,000 a year for three years to help build the resilience of KiwiHarvest in the Southern Lakes region.
